When the car is in motion, the baby must be buckled up. The harness straps must be snug enough such that you cannot pinch a horizontal crease at the collar bone. Otherwise she'll be ejected if someone crashes into you. Ejected passengers are about 4 times likely to die. If she weighs only 15 pounds & the car is going only 30MPH during a crash, she will suffer about 450 pounds of force.
